Four charged with Mumbai blasts
All four were arrested under India's tough anti-terrorism law.
Three of them Syed Rahim, 45, Fahimida Syed Mohammed Hanif, 37, and their daughter Farheen Rahim, 18 appeared in a Bombay court yesterday. The city, India's financial hub, was the target of twin bombings last week which killed 52 people and wounded 150 others. The fourth suspect, Arshad Ansari, 26, was in hospital with high blood pressure.
